Job Description

The role of a transmission line engineer includes the scoping, design, construction, and analysis of the physical infrastructure (predominantly structures and wires) that enables the transfer of high voltage electricity. For an entry level candidate this role operates with guidance and mentoring from experienced engineers. For those with professional experience, more independence is expected. This role operates as part of a multi-disciplinary team to execute projects from initiation through final construction and closeout. The role is governed by strict safety and design standards but often requires creative thinking and problem solving to find solutions that satisfy all customers/stakeholders.

Ideal candidates should have knowledge and/or experience with large construction projects, project scoping, scheduling and material ordering.

Additional experience with any of the software or concepts below is a plus:

Transmission line routing

Plan and Profile drawings

PLS-CADD Software and/or structural analysis

FAD Tools Software and/or foundation design

Project/Construction management

Note: A Bachelor of Science degree in a Civil Engineering discipline program is preferred (other disciplines will be considered).

Basic Qualifications:

Engineer Associate (Grade 05): ($65,000-$80,000)

This is an entry level position for new graduates with a Bachelor's degree in engineering in a program accredited by ABET*

Engineer (Grade 06): ($75,000-$85,000)

Has typically acquired two (2 )or more years of related engineering experience along with a Bachelor's degree in engineering in a program accredited by ABET; Note: Individuals with a Master's degree in engineering from an engineering program accredited by ABET may be considered for entry into the organization at this level.

Engineer (Grade 07): ($85,000-$105,000)

Has typically acquired 4 or more years of related engineering experience along with a bachelor's degree in engineering in a program accredited by ABET; or 2 years of related engineering experience along with a Master’s degree in engineering from a program accredited by ABET .

Individuals with a PhD in engineering from an engineering program accredited by ABET* may be considered for entry into the organization at this level.

Registration as a Professional Engineer (PE) in any U.S. state or Puerto Rico* is encouraged and preferred.ABET - Engineering Accreditation Commission of the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ology.

*ABET - Engineering Accreditation Commission of the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ology.

Acceptable alternatives are:

Bachelor's degree in engineering (non-ABET), plus a Professional Engineers (PE) license in any state of the U.S. or

Bachelor's degree in engineering (non-ABET) plus a Master's degree or PhD in engineering from a university with an ABET accredited Bachelor's program.
